Deerfell B&B
Deerfell B&B lies secluded on the south west side of National Trust Blackdown Hill, with wonderful views towards the South Downs and coast. Rooms are peaceful and comfortable with en-suite bath/shower, tea/coffee making facilities and a television - one double with separate bath/shower. Guests have the use of a comfortable sitting room with open fire, and breakfast is served in the attractive dining room. Many places of interest are within easy reach, and London is accessible from nearby Haslemere station only 4 miles away. Single occupancy £38.
